I am a Consultant Trauma and Orthopaedic Surgeon at Portsmouth NHS Trust. My special clinical interests include knee surgery, knee arthroplasty (replacement), arthroscopy and knee ligament reconstruction.

My special clinical interests are in arthroscopy, osteoarthritis, soft tissue injury, sports injury, arthritis, bone grafts, bursitis and knee ligament injuries. My research interest is in rotating bearing total knee replacements.

Mr Niall Flynn is Chair of the Medical Advisory Committee at Spire Portsmouth Hospital. Their role is to provide senior professional advice to the Hospital Director and Director of Clinical Services in order to support effective medical governance and oversight. They are paid £14,000 per annum for this role and are also entitled to receive the following fees for the provision of additional ad hoc services: (i) £750 for chairing a Professional Review Committee; (ii) £200 per hour for attendance at regulatory or other national body meeting (capped at £500); (iii) £500 for each annual medical appraisal undertaken for a doctor designating to Spire for the purposes of revalidation; (iv) £1,000 per annum for undertaking the role of governance lead in addition to MAC Chair; and (v) £200 per hour for the preparation of an independent report (up to a maximum of £500 per report unless otherwise agreed due to complexity) upon request by the Medical Director or Chief Medical Officer
